<feed xmlns='http://www.w3.org/2005/Atom'>
<title>delta/gitlab/gitlab-ce.git, branch enable-shared-runners-with-admins</title>
<subtitle>gitlab.com: gitlab-org/gitlab-ce.git
</subtitle>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/'/>
<entry>
<title>Disable Metrics/CyclomaticComplexity for Ability.allowed</title>
<updated>2016-06-30T13:38:29+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-30T13:38:29+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=63477fd27f3eeff5d5f612b27ed71c76926934d2'/>
<id>63477fd27f3eeff5d5f612b27ed71c76926934d2</id>
<content type='text'>
There's little point to cut that down.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
There's little point to cut that down.
</pre>
</div>
</content>
</entry>
<entry>
<title>Use warning for locked runners:</title>
<updated>2016-06-30T13:26:50+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-30T13:26:50+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=59413153f574c939ca9652d9684410a9608a93c2'/>
<id>59413153f574c939ca9652d9684410a9608a93c2</id>
<content type='text'>
Feedback from:
https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/4961#note_12794221
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Feedback from:
https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/4961#note_12794221
</pre>
</div>
</content>
</entry>
<entry>
<title>Use Ability to check pre-requisite. Change back to 403 because:</title>
<updated>2016-06-29T11:04:06+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-29T11:04:06+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=23a3ce946ad0f7ef1c63036bf313cd549d18f0ab'/>
<id>23a3ce946ad0f7ef1c63036bf313cd549d18f0ab</id>
<content type='text'>
If we're using `can?` it would look weird to use 409
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
If we're using `can?` it would look weird to use 409
</pre>
</div>
</content>
</entry>
<entry>
<title>Admins should be able to assign locked runners as well</title>
<updated>2016-06-28T12:15:50+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-28T12:15:50+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=deb5509f7bc3eec8fa47939144a52cda7d408625'/>
<id>deb5509f7bc3eec8fa47939144a52cda7d408625</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>They're projects, so we shouldn't show lock icon</title>
<updated>2016-06-28T12:10:42+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-28T12:10:42+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=2b5211833342fb31201030d84a9e0caf2c8cceb8'/>
<id>2b5211833342fb31201030d84a9e0caf2c8cceb8</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Allow admins to assign locked runners:</title>
<updated>2016-06-28T11:55:12+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-28T11:55:12+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=397a69f834ad8854301df4c09035e16d35ac5158'/>
<id>397a69f834ad8854301df4c09035e16d35ac5158</id>
<content type='text'>
And show information about locked status.

Help! This looks bad :o
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
And show information about locked status.

Help! This looks bad :o
</pre>
</div>
</content>
</entry>
<entry>
<title>Use 409 to indicate that interface might be outdated</title>
<updated>2016-06-28T11:54:18+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-28T11:54:18+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=b5c8d58afb7840acd9c26129b2ff0c0fe3f2586e'/>
<id>b5c8d58afb7840acd9c26129b2ff0c0fe3f2586e</id>
<content type='text'>
Because invalid actions shouldn't be shown on the page.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Because invalid actions shouldn't be shown on the page.
</pre>
</div>
</content>
</entry>
<entry>
<title>Rename to assignable runner for shared examples:</title>
<updated>2016-06-28T10:33:25+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-28T10:33:25+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=d08777b1a4ead4cc15089e9d0d333d91de56ee1e'/>
<id>d08777b1a4ead4cc15089e9d0d333d91de56ee1e</id>
<content type='text'>
Feedback:
https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/4961#note_12738607
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Feedback:
https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/4961#note_12738607
</pre>
</div>
</content>
</entry>
<entry>
<title>Admin should be able to turn shared runners into specific ones:</title>
<updated>2016-06-28T05:46:47+00:00</updated>
<author>
<name>Lin Jen-Shin</name>
<email>godfat@godfat.org</email>
</author>
<published>2016-06-28T05:46:47+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=95c99cd4fd0f768394d582ac49dc83ac93d9c1e5'/>
<id>95c99cd4fd0f768394d582ac49dc83ac93d9c1e5</id>
<content type='text'>
The regression was introduced by:

https://gitlab.com/gitlab-org/gitlab-ce/commit/1b8f52d9206bdf19c0dde04505c4c0b1cf46cfbe

I did that because there's a test specifying that a shared runner cannot
be enabled, in the API. So I assume that is the case for non-admin, but
admins should be able to do so anyway.

Also added a test to make sure this won't regress again.

Closes #19039
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The regression was introduced by:

https://gitlab.com/gitlab-org/gitlab-ce/commit/1b8f52d9206bdf19c0dde04505c4c0b1cf46cfbe

I did that because there's a test specifying that a shared runner cannot
be enabled, in the API. So I assume that is the case for non-admin, but
admins should be able to do so anyway.

Also added a test to make sure this won't regress again.

Closes #19039
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ge remote-tracking branch 'dev/master'</title>
<updated>2016-06-27T22:39:42+00:00</updated>
<author>
<name>Robert Speicher</name>
<email>rspeicher@gmail.com</email>
</author>
<published>2016-06-27T22:36:08+00:00</published>
<link rel='alternate' type='text/html' href='http://git.baserock.org/cgit/delta/gitlab/gitlab-ce.git/commit/?id=c9a46263336dd38aef90b71995e2790be72d441d'/>
<id>c9a46263336dd38aef90b71995e2790be72d441d</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
</feed>
